Skip to content

Commit

Permalink
Merge branch 'release/3.24.2'
Browse files Browse the repository at this point in the history
  • Loading branch information
msqr committed Jul 11, 2024
2 parents 86715d2 + 5b785fe commit 33ae3f7
Show file tree
Hide file tree
Showing 5 changed files with 17 additions and 17 deletions.
2 changes: 1 addition & 1 deletion solarnet/ocpp/build.gradle
Original file line number Diff line number Diff line change
Expand Up @@ -14,7 +14,7 @@ dependencyManagement {
}

description = 'SolarNet: OCPP'
version = '2.6.0'
version = '2.6.1'

base {
archivesName = 'solarnet-ocpp'
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-22,10 +22,8 @@

package net.solarnetwork.central.ocpp.config;

import javax.sql.DataSource;
import org.mybatis.spring.SqlSessionTemplate;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.boot.context.properties.ConfigurationProperties;
import org.springframework.context.annotation.Bean;
import org.springframework.context.annotation.Configuration;
import org.springframework.jdbc.core.JdbcOperations;
Expand All @@ -38,7 +36,6 @@
import net.solarnetwork.central.ocpp.dao.ChargePointSettingsDao;
import net.solarnetwork.central.ocpp.dao.ChargePointStatusDao;
import net.solarnetwork.central.ocpp.dao.UserSettingsDao;
import net.solarnetwork.central.ocpp.dao.jdbc.AsyncJdbcChargePointActionStatusDao;
import net.solarnetwork.central.ocpp.dao.jdbc.JdbcChargePointActionStatusDao;
import net.solarnetwork.central.ocpp.dao.jdbc.JdbcChargePointStatusDao;
import net.solarnetwork.central.ocpp.dao.mybatis.MyBatisCentralAuthorizationDao;
Expand All @@ -53,7 +50,7 @@
* OCPP DAO configuration.
*
* @author matt
* @version 1.0
* @version 1.1
*/
@Configuration(proxyBeanMethods = false)
public class OcppDaoConfig {
Expand All @@ -64,9 +61,6 @@ public class OcppDaoConfig {
@Autowired
private JdbcOperations jdbcOperations;

@Autowired
private DataSource dataSource;

@Bean
public CentralAuthorizationDao ocppCentralAuthorizationDao() {
MyBatisCentralAuthorizationDao dao = new MyBatisCentralAuthorizationDao();
Expand Down Expand Up @@ -126,10 +120,4 @@ public ChargePointActionStatusDao ocppChargePointActionStatusDao() {
return new JdbcChargePointActionStatusDao(jdbcOperations);
}

@ConfigurationProperties(prefix = "app.ocpp.async-action-status-updater")
@Bean(initMethod = "serviceDidStartup", destroyMethod = "serviceDidShutdown")
public AsyncJdbcChargePointActionStatusDao ocppChargePointActionStatusUpdateDao() {
return new AsyncJdbcChargePointActionStatusDao(dataSource);
}

}
2 changes: 1 addition & 1 deletion solarnet/solarocpp/build.gradle
Original file line number Diff line number Diff line change
Expand Up @@ -9,7 +9,7 @@ apply plugin: 'org.springframework.boot'
apply plugin: 'io.spring.dependency-management'

description = 'SolarOCPP'
version = '2.9.0'
version = '2.9.1'

base {
archivesName = 'solarocpp'
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-22,23 +22,29 @@

package net.solarnetwork.central.in.ocpp.config;

import javax.sql.DataSource;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.boot.context.properties.ConfigurationProperties;
import org.springframework.context.annotation.Bean;
import org.springframework.context.annotation.Configuration;
import org.springframework.context.annotation.Primary;
import org.springframework.scheduling.TaskScheduler;
import net.solarnetwork.central.ocpp.dao.AsyncChargePointStatusDao;
import net.solarnetwork.central.ocpp.dao.ChargePointStatusDao;
import net.solarnetwork.central.ocpp.dao.jdbc.AsyncJdbcChargePointActionStatusDao;

/**
* OCPP DAO configuration.
*
* @author matt
* @version 1.0
* @version 1.1
*/
@Configuration(proxyBeanMethods = false)
public class OcppInDaoConfig {

@Autowired
private DataSource dataSource;

@ConfigurationProperties(prefix = "app.ocpp.async-status-updater")
@Bean(initMethod = "serviceDidStartup", destroyMethod = "serviceDidShutdown")
@Primary
Expand All @@ -47,4 +53,10 @@ public ChargePointStatusDao ocppAsyncChargePointStatusDao(TaskScheduler taskSche
return new AsyncChargePointStatusDao(taskScheduler, delegate);
}

@ConfigurationProperties(prefix = "app.ocpp.async-action-status-updater")
@Bean(initMethod = "serviceDidStartup", destroyMethod = "serviceDidShutdown")
public AsyncJdbcChargePointActionStatusDao ocppChargePointActionStatusUpdateDao() {
return new AsyncJdbcChargePointActionStatusDao(dataSource);
}

}
2 changes: 1 addition & 1 deletion solarnet/solaruser/build.gradle
Original file line number Diff line number Diff line change
Expand Up @@ -11,7 +11,7 @@ apply plugin: 'org.springframework.boot'
apply plugin: 'io.spring.dependency-management'

description = 'SolarUser'
version = '2.15.2'
version = '2.15.3'

base {
archivesName = 'solaruser'
Expand Down

0 comments on commit 33ae3f7

Please sign in to comment.